Springfield livestock market report

The Springfield Livestock Marketing Center, Springfield, Mo., reported receipts of 3,100 head Oct. 19, compared to 3,300 head last week and 2,975 head last year, according to the USDA Market News Service, Jefferson City, Mo.

Compared to last week, steer calves under 550 pounds sold steady to $1 lower with those weighing from 550 to 650 pounds selling $2 to $4 lower. Heifer calves under 650 pounds traded steady to $3 higher. A light offering of yearling feeders and calves over 650 pounds sold fully steady. All weights of Holstein steers were $2 to $5 higher. Calf demand was very good, despite heavy numbers of calves currently hitting the markets across the Midwest and reports of high sickness and death loss rates in the high plains feedlots and backgrounding yards. The supply included 44% steers, 35% heifers, 13% Holsteins, and 8% feeder bulls. Around 27% of the cattle weighed over 600 pounds.
